Features house building in Russia

Naturally, the question arises, how did they manage without the insulation of the house from the outside? After all, wooden houses were built in Russia since ancient times, they stood for centuries.

It should be understood that the old and reliable log house and a modern house from a bar are slightly different concepts. Until the 20th century, only chopped wood was used for buildings. Preference in carpentry was given to the ax, although the saw was known in Russia since ancient times.

But it was believed that the sawn wood absorbs moisture more strongly, swells and rot. And the wood in logs that are treated with an ax, as if clogged under his blows and does not absorb moisture.

Houses were built without nails, there were several ways to cut logs. The cups were cut down strictly according to the shape of the logs that fit in them, in the crowns they made a longitudinal groove for better log house density. Carefully caulked the joints of the logs.

All this gave the effect of solidity. The thickness of the logs in the log house was sufficient to maintain heat.

House with a male roof, nineteenth century.

Another feature was the construction of a log house under the very roof, the construction of which in this case was called mats. This type of structure was especially widely distributed in the north of Russia. The logs were raised to the very roof, they built the triangle of the pediment, on which they fastened the slings for tesa.

So, we see the following features that did not allow traditional wooden houses to be made in Russia:

  1. wall thickness sufficient to maintain heat;
  2. solidity of the walls, achieved by the density of logs and caulking cracks;
  3. low level of hygroscopicity of wood due to its processing with an ax.

Modern house of timber

Modern house from a bar with a section of 150 mm.

For a normal level of microclimate in the house, when winter frost blows, it is necessary to build a house out of a bar with a thickness of 40 cm. If the cross section of the bar is smaller, it will not be possible to retain heat, the problem cannot be solved with a caulk of slots. After all, the timber simply by itself will freeze through in extreme cold.

In modern housing construction timber is used with a cross section of 150 mm, so this house has to be insulated from the outside or from the inside. The most appropriate to achieve the desired effect is considered external warming log house.

The level of hygroscopicity is reduced by treating the bar with special impregnations. With the help of various methods of outdoor insulation it will be possible to achieve the effect of solidity and sufficient thickness of the walls, the main thing is to find the right answer to the question of what is better to warm the house from the bar outside.

The procedure for insulation work

Consider how to properly insulate the outside of a log house, what stages of work must be performed and in what sequence.

In order for the air vapor passing through the thickness of the beam, did not turn into water in the thickness of the insulation, it is necessary to make a vapor barrier. The best option would be to hold it from the inside of the walls by running from the foil material reflecting heat inside the room.

Variant of warming the walls of the house from a bar with vapor insulation inside the room (1-outer sheathing, 2-counter-rail, 3 windscreens, 4 - insulation, 5 - load-bearing wall).

Consider how to insulate a bar-shaped house outside, when the interior has been completed and it is necessary to provide for a wind insulation device outside (read also the article Decorating a house from a bar inside on its own).

You must do this in the following order:

  1. we fill the vertical crate on the outer walls of the edged board with a thickness of 40-50 mm;
  2. we fasten the boards with a continuous sheet with an overlapping vapor barrier membrane;
  3. we fill the second layer of the lathing on the same boards with a step suitable for the chosen heater;
  4. we lay a heater between bars;
  5. we lay a film or membrane for wind protection;
  6. we fix a wind protection with counter racks;
  7. Mounted on rails outer lining.

Important. Parobaryer walls should have air ducts arranged from below and above. This is necessary for air circulation and balancing the temperature in the area of ​​the gap and the temperature in the interior.
